**Mgmt Meeting Minutes — Retiring the Brightline Range**

Quick recap for sales leads at Fenholt Supplies: we agreed to retire the Brightline fixture range by year-end. Remaining stock moves to clearance pricing next month, and accounts on standing orders get migrated to the Lumetta range. Trade-in incentives were approved in principle. The confidential note on next steps sits just below.

board note of bajof-bajeg: The pricing group signed off on a budget of $13.4 million for Project Sildor. The renewal with Lamixek Holdings closes at $48.9 million a year, 49 percent above the last contract.

Re: Retirement of the Stonebriar product line

Stonebriar sales have declined for five consecutive quarters and support costs now exceed contribution margin. The retirement plan is staged: new orders close end of Q2, existing contracts honoured through their terms, and spares stocked for twenty-four months. Sales leads should steer prospects toward the Ashgrove range; migration incentives are already approved. Customer comms are drafted and awaiting legal sign-off. The forward strategy behind this decision is set out in the note below.

confidential, yafog-hagug: Gross margin on Druix came in at 10 percent against a plan of 15 percent. Only 5 of the 80 pilot accounts renewed Druix, so a churn review is set for October 1.

**Internal Memo — Regional Sales Review**

To all branch managers: the mid-year review of the Kestral Range territory is complete. Overall revenue rose 4%, driven by the Bremora product line, while the Southgate corridor declined for a third straight quarter. Velda Prinn will schedule individual debriefs over the next two weeks. Update your forecasts in the planning tool before those meetings. The confidential note on forward business plans is included directly below.

board note of kageg-bahof: The renewal with Holwynax Holdings closes at $2 million a year, 5 percent below the last contract. Project Ulaath slips by two quarters because of the supplier delay.